I'm trying to install IDES 4.7 Retail on a 64-bit Dual XEON machine on Windows 2003 Enterprise x64.
I have used the AMD64 version of JDK 1.4.2, but I don't think it's helping. The first time I ran JDK 1.4.2.13 AMD64, the java setup threw a warning/error that the architecture is not compatible. It worked fine the next time I ran it.
MS SQL 2000 has installed itself as a 32-bit version!! And later on, SAPINST failed to install when running the file setup.cmd (from installation CD #5039652) -- it uses JAVA_HOME to detect the processor's architecture and it looks for AMD64 directory inside the installation directory, which does not exist (only I386 exists).
